A barcode reader (or barcode scanner) is an electronic device for reading printed barcodes. Like a flatbed scanner, it consists of a light source, a lens and a light sensor translating optical impulses into electrical ones. Additionally, nearly all barcode readers contain decoder circuitry analyzing the barcode's image data provided by the sensor and sending the barcode's content to the scanner's output port.

A UPC barcode identifies an item by a series of black lines with numbers underneath. It allows for data on such items to be stored such as what the item is as well as price.
The Barcode Scanner was Invented and Patened in 1952 by Norman Joseph Woodland of Ohio, USA

If you own a company or are looking to start getting barcodes is definitely a must. The most common way to get a barcode is to look up and register your product with a place called GS1. There might be other ways but GS1 is the most common route to go.
